Volvo’s flagship luxury SUV, the 2025 XC90, has officially arrived in India, bringing a refreshed design, tech upgrades, and enhanced performance. Priced at ₹1.03 crore (ex-showroom), the latest iteration of this Swedish powerhouse continues to position itself as a strong contender in the luxury SUV segment, competing with the BMW X5, Mercedes-Benz GLE, and Audi Q7.

Step Inside: A Cabin Designed for Digital-First Luxury
In 2025, luxury isn’t just about plush leather seats—it’s about intelligent technology, seamless connectivity, and an immersive driving experience. Volvo has upgraded the XC90’s cabin to cater to the needs of tech-savvy, experience-driven buyers.
📱 A bigger 11.2-inch portrait touchscreen replaces the older 9-inch unit, now running Google-based software with over-the-air (OTA) updates.
🌍 Seamless integration with Google Assistant, Maps, and Play Store—perfect for long drives and navigation convenience.
🔊 A premium Bowers & Wilkins sound system delivers an immersive music experience.
☀️ A panoramic sunroof adds to the airy, luxurious feel.
❄️ Four-zone climate control & an air purifier with PM 2.5 filtration ensure a healthier cabin environment.
With wireless charging, ventilated seats, and a 360-degree camera, the XC90 offers a blend of luxury and smart functionality, making it a perfect fit for modern Indian premium car buyers who demand comfort with cutting-edge tech.
Performance: Power Meets Efficiency
The XC90 is powered by a 2.0L mild-hybrid turbo-petrol engine, producing:
🔹 250 hp and 360 Nm of torque
🔹 Paired with an 8-speed automatic transmission
🔹 0-100 km/h in just 7.7 seconds
The mild-hybrid system not only boosts efficiency but also aligns with Volvo’s vision for sustainable luxury mobility. With all-wheel drive as standard, the XC90 is ready for highway cruising and off-road adventures alike.
Built for India: Size, Comfort & Safety
Luxury SUVs need to be spacious, comfortable, and built for Indian road conditions. The XC90 delivers on all fronts:
📏 Length: 4,953 mm | Width: 1,931 mm | Height: 1,773 mm
🚦 Wheelbase: 2,984 mm for superior stability
🌍 Ground Clearance: 238mm (up to 267mm with air suspension)
Volvo is synonymous with safety, and the XC90 continues to uphold that reputation with:
✔️ Adaptive Cruise Control & Pilot Assist
✔️ Collision Avoidance & Lane-Keep Assist
✔️ Blind Spot Detection & Rear Cross-Traffic Alert
For Indian highways and city traffic, these features ensure a stress-free and secure driving experience.
